  9. I had a similar issue including the vanishing network-rules.cfg after each restart... (btw, for this everybody replying to a previous thread of mine insists i have something installed that removes it, which is actually not the case. i still think that its unraid itself removing the file due to reasons during startup after reading it.) The machine has 2 NICs, the onboard (which whyever cannot be disabled in the bios) and the 10GBit Nic Here is my network-rules.cfg: SUBSYSTEM=="net", ACTION=="add", DRIVERS=="?*", ATTR{address}=="e4:1d:9c:92:ce:44", ATTR{dev_id}=="0x0", ATTR{type}=="1", KERNEL=="eth*", NAME="eth0" SUBSYSTEM=="net", ACTION=="add", DRIVERS=="?*", ATTR{address}=="22:48:5c:05:16:45", ATTR{dev_id}=="0x0", ATTR{type}=="1", KERNEL=="eth*", NAME="eth1" It is merely to make sure the 10GBit is eth0 because Unraid has some special handling for eth0 as we all know... As well, I made sure its there before restarting the server (user script just writes it to /boot/config each hour ) hope this helps you as well

  11. just for your info.... tailscales magic dns might break your docker containers. /etc/resolv.conf gets copied to all freshly started contaieners from the host, which points to a dns not existing inside the container... disabling magic dns resolved this issue.
